Who Knew by Barry Diller is an autobiographical memoir by the prominent media executive detailing his extensive career and experiences across the entertainment and business sectors. The book was discussed on Acquired during a live event at Radio City Music Hall, where host David Rosenthal brought up the memoir while speaking with the author. Rosenthal praised the book as excellent, specifically noting how the initial chapters chronicle the foundational period of Diller's career working in Hollywood.
